Took about 10 weekends to complete, but here it is. It’s made from plans from Handyman Magazine, 2014 if I remember right. I’ve done a bit of carpentry before but never a project foundation to roof. Really pleased with how it turned out.
Everything, with the exception of the windows was made onsite.
